Tyler Shields (born April 29, 1982){{cite web |url=http://www.1883magazine.com/art-exhibitions/art-exhibition/chromatic-by-tyler-shields |title=Chromatic by Tyler Shields |author=Jacopo Nuvolari |website=1883 Magazine |publisher=GlamStyle |accessdate=5 July 2013}} is an American photographer,{{cite web|last1=Taete|first1=Jamie Lee Curtis|title=Is Celebrity Photographer Tyler Shields Inspired, Or Copying Other Artists?|url=https://www.vice.com/en_us/article/has-celebrity-photographer-tyler-shields-ripped-off-other-artists-on-his-way-to-fame|work=Vice|accessdate=June 1, 2017|date=January 15, 2016}} screenwriter, director, and former professional inline skater. Shields is known for his provocative photography involving violence and danger.
Shields gained additional notoriety in June 2017 for a photo of comedian Kathy Griffin holding a prop that looked like Donald Trump's severed head.
Life and career
=Inline skating=
Shields competed professionally as a vert inline skater. He participated in the 1999 and 2000 X Games and toured with Tony Hawk in 2003.{{cite news|last=Clark|first=Ryan F.|title=Hawk Still Stoked Over Tricks Of Trade|url=https://www.orlandosentinel.com/2003/01/11/hawk-still-stoked-over-tricks-of-trade/|access-date=June 11, 2012|newspaper=Orlando Sentinel|date=January 11, 2003}}{{cite web|title=The 1999 ASA Pro Tour jams N2 Ontario CA|url=http://thedesktop.com/n2inline/html/news_asa_pro99fin.html|publisher=N2inline.Com|accessdate=June 11, 2012|date=June 3, 1999}}{{cite news|last=Tomalin|first=Terry|title=Edgy sport keeps generation in-line|url=http://www.sptimes.com/News/051900/news_pf/Outdoors/Edgy_sport_keeps_gene.shtml|newspaper=St. Petersburg Times|accessdate=June 11, 2012|date=May 19, 2000}}
=Photography=
Shields credits Fraser Kee Scott of A Gallery with discovering him, stating, "I have a lot of friends that are Scientologists ... Fraser [Kee Scott], the guy who runs that gallery, he found me back in the MySpace days. He is a very, very fucking smart guy and he has a great eye for things. He worked at my last gallery and to my knowledge he wasn't promoting Scientology to anybody, he was trying to sell art."{{cite web|url=http://www.blouinartinfo.com/features/article/38260-whats-lindsay-lohan-doing-with-that-knife-a-qa-with-tyler-shields-young-hollywoods-hottest-and-most-twisted-photographer|title=What's Lindsay Lohan Doing With That Knife?: A Q&A With Tyler Shields, Young Hollywood's Hottest and Most Twisted Photographer |author=Ann Binlot |date=12 August 2011 |website=Blouin Artinfo|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20130927103222/http://www.blouinartinfo.com/features/article/38260-whats-lindsay-lohan-doing-with-that-knife-a-qa-with-tyler-shields-young-hollywoods-hottest-and-most-twisted-photographer|archive-date=27 September 2013 |publisher=Blouin Media |accessdate=5 July 2013}}
In August 2009, Shields participated in a photoshoot with The Vampire Diaries cast members Nina Dobrev, Candice Accola, Kayla Ewell and Sara Canning at Rumble Road Bridge, Smarr, Georgia.{{Cite web |title='Vamp Diaries' Chicks Busted for Being Flash Mob |url=https://www.tmz.com/2009/09/11/vampire-diaries-mugshots-nina-dobrev-arrest/ |access-date=2022-06-19 |website=TMZ |language=en}} The group was arrested and charged with disorderly conduct after reports from the public sighted some of the members hanging off the bridge.{{Cite web |title=TV Starlets Behind Bars |url=https://www.thesmokinggun.com/file/tv-starlets-behind-bars?page=6 |access-date=2022-06-19 |website=The Smoking Gun |language=en}}{{Cite news |last=Matteucci |first=Megan |title=Vampire Diaries' stars arrested in Ga. |language=English |work=The Atlanta Journal-Constitution |url=https://www.ajc.com/entertainment/celebrity-news/vampire-diaries-stars-arrested/SeKwoFqLpzvQmLgrpdyGyH/ |access-date=2022-06-20 |issn=1539-7459}}{{Cite web |date=2010-07-21 |title=TV Starlets Behind Bars |url=https://www.thesmokinggun.com/documents/crime/tv-starlets-behind-bars |access-date=2022-06-19 |website=The Smoking Gun |language=en}}
Shields has exhibited several series of photographs. In January 2016, Vanity Fair featured some of Shields' photographs of Colton Haynes and Emily Bett.{{cite web|last1=Rich|first1=Katey|title=Exclusive: Colton Haynes Dons Drag with Emily Bett Rickards|url=http://www.vanityfair.com/hollywood/2016/01/colton-haynes-drag-emily-bett-rickards-tyler-shields|website=www.vanityfair.com|publisher=Vanity Fair|accessdate=June 24, 2016|date=January 14, 2016}} Shields' series "Historical Fiction" [2015] featured a black man hanging a KKK member.{{cite web|url=http://www.thedailybeast.com/articles/2015/05/13/a-black-man-hangs-a-white-supremacist-tyler-shields-s-charged-photography.html|title=A Black Man Hangs a White Supremacist: Tyler Shields's Charged Photography|first=Justin|last=Jones|website=The Daily Beast |date=13 May 2015|publisher=|accessdate=25 November 2016}} The series covered events such as the deaths of James Dean, John F. Kennedy, Martin Luther King Jr., and Marilyn Monroe; the first men on the moon; and the break-up of The Beatles.{{cite web|url=http://www.hasselblad.com/our-world/news/historical-fiction-by-tyler-shields|title=Historical Fiction by Tyler Shields – Our World – Hasselblad|publisher=|accessdate=25 November 2016}} In his 2014 series Provocateur, he had an alligator biting a crocodile bag.{{cite web|url=http://www.huffingtonpost.com/2014/05/15/alligator-bites-birkin-bag_n_5332923.html|title=Alligator Takes A Big Bite Out Of $100,000 Crocodile Birkin Bag|first=Carly Ledbetter Huffington Post Entertainment|last=Writer|website=HuffPost |date=15 May 2014|publisher=|accessdate=25 November 2016}} Another photograph from this series, Three Witches, was included as part of the Sotheby's auction in London.{{cite web|url=http://www.sothebys.com/en/auctions/ecatalogue/2016/photographs-l16780/lot.19.html|title=shields tyler 'three witches' 2014 – fashion – sotheby's l16780lot8zydzen|publisher=}} His photograph "Bunny" was featured in the Phillip's London auction.{{cite web|url=http://www.phillips.com/detail/TYLER-SHIELDS/UK040215/22|title=PHILLIPS : UK040215, TYLER-SHIELDS|publisher=}}
Some observers, including Henry Leutwyler, art critic Paddy Johnson,{{cite web |last1=Johnson |first1=Paddy |last2=Farley |first2=Michael Anthony |title=Tyler Shields is A Terrible Artist. Kathy Griffin is Just His Accomplice. |url=http://artfcity.com/2017/06/01/tyler-shields-is-a-terrible-artist-kathy-griffin-is-just-his-accomplice/ |website=ArtFCity |accessdate=August 10, 2020 |date=June 1, 2017}} and writer/photographer Jamie Lee Curtis Taete, have said that Tyler Shields takes other artists' concepts and passes them off as his own.{{cite web|url=https://www.vice.com/en_us/article/qbx9dd/has-celebrity-photographer-tyler-shields-ripped-off-other-artists-on-his-way-to-fame|title=Is Celebrity Photographer Tyler Shields Inspired, Or Copying Other Artists?}}
Tyler Shields has written two books of photography. His first photography book, The Dirty Side of Glamour, was released in November 2013 and published by Harper Collins' subsidiary Dey Street Books.{{cite web |title=Tyler Shields Talks Debut Photo Book 'The Dirty Side of Glamour' (Exclusive Image) |author=Ashley Lee |url=http://www.hollywoodreporter.com/news/tyler-shields-dirty-side-glamour-lindsay-lohan-demi-lovato-356418 |work=The Hollywood Reporter |date=August 2, 2012 |accessdate= July 13, 2017}} His second book, Provocateur, was published in January 2017.{{Cite book|last1=Shields|first1=Tyler|title=Provocateur: Photographs|isbn=978-1943876297|via=amazon.com|date=January 3, 2017 |publisher=Glitterati}}
Shields' work often involves images of violence and danger.{{cite news|url=http://www.laweekly.com/2011-11-10/art-books/tyler-shields-warhol-or-wannabe/|publisher=LAWeekly|title=Tyler Shields: Warhol or Wannabe?|author=Lina Lecaro|date=10 November 2011|accessdate=28 November 2011}} He collected blood from 20 celebrities to make a piece of art for his Life Is Not a Fairytale exhibit in Los Angeles[http://www.star-magazine.co.uk/breakingnews/view/29242/Shields-collects-stars-blood-for-artwork/ Shields collects stars' blood for artwork] Star (magazine) April 7, 2011 and also photographed Lindsay Lohan as a vampire for that exhibit.[http://www.dailytimes.com.pk/default.asp?page=2011\05\10\story_10-5-2011_pg9_8 Lindsay poses as vampire in new Tyler Shields’ exhibit] Tuesday, Daily Times May 10, 2011 In 2010, Shields photographed Lohan in studio portraits brandishing a gun.{{cite magazine|last=Oh |first=Eunice |url=http://www.people.com/people/article/0,,20365187,00.html|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20100502032251/http://www.people.com/people/article/0,,20365187,00.html|url-status=dead|archive-date=May 2, 2010|title=PHOTO: Lindsay Lohan with Gun to Her Mouth |magazine=People |date=2010-04-29 |access-date=2010-05-26}} Shields was criticized for a photoshoot with Glee star Heather Morris with a bruised eye as making light of abusive treatment of women.{{cite news|url=http://www.huffingtonpost.com/2011/09/02/heather-morris-photo-shoot_n_946721.html|title=Heather Morris Poses For Domestic Abuse-Themed Shoot (PHOTOS)|author=Ellie Krupnick|date=2 September 2011|accessdate=28 November 2011|work=Huffington Post}} His oeuvre has been criticized as copying other photographers' work.{{cite web|last1=Leutwyler|first1=Harry|title=Everyone wants to be successful until they see what it actually takes? (Harry Leutwyler Instagram account)|url=https://www.instagram.com/p/0sIJR4D3fT/ |archive-url=https://ghostarchive.org/iarchive/instagram/henryleutwyler/949169443509860307 |archive-date=December 25, 2021 |url-access=registration|accessdate=June 1, 2017|date=March 26, 2015|quote=@henryleutwyler @thetylershields just for the sake of the argument, this is the original photograph. I find it somehow offensive to attribute yourself the "creation" of it ‼️ #thetylershields}}{{cbignore}}
In 2017, Shields' photograph of Kathy Griffin holding a "bloody head resembling" U.S. President Donald Trump's face caused an uproar, causing both Donald Trump Jr. and Chelsea Clinton to denounce the act.{{cite news|url=http://www.cnn.com/2017/05/30/entertainment/kathy-griffin-trump-tyler-shields/|title=Kathy Griffin: 'I beg for your forgiveness' for gruesome anti-Trump photo shoot |author=Sandra Gomez|date=30 May 2017|accessdate=30 May 2017|publisher=CNN}} Griffin later criticized Shields for refusing to grant her the photograph's copyright, as well as the comparatively minor amount of public criticism experienced by Shields compared to herself, which Griffin attributed to sexism.{{cite news|last1=Schneller|first1=Johanna|title="Kathy Griffin is using her Trump photo controversy to fuel a world tour"|url=https://www.theglobeandmail.com/arts/theatre-and-performance/article-saving-her-sorries-kathy-griffin-is-using-her-trump-photo-controversy/|accessdate=May 24, 2018|newspaper=The Globe and Mail|date=May 17, 2018}}
In 2010, Shields was brought on as a co-founder and photography editor by The Printed Blog.{{cite web |date=2010-06-19 |title=After a dark spell, the Printed Blog returns {{pipe}} Small Business {{pipe}} Blogs {{pipe}} Crain's Chicago Business |url=http://www.chicagobusiness.com/section/blogs?blogID=enterprise-city&plckController=Blog&plckBlogPage=BlogViewPost&uid=16ea2629-7e90-46f0-a706-dd6152764513&plckPostId=Blog%3A16ea2629-7e90-46f0-a706-dd6152764513Post%3Af5c99498-14b8-41ca-8872-90435daf375e&plckScript=blogScript&plckElementId=blogDest |accessdate=2011-05-30 |publisher=Chicagobusiness.com}}
=Filmmaking=
On December 15, 2014, Shields' script The Wild Ones was featured in the Black List, an annual list of the most well-liked unproduced screenplays.{{cite web|last1=Jagernauth|first1=Kevin|title=Watch: Elizabeth Banks, Daniel Radcliffe, Rian Johnson & More Announce 2014 Black List, Plus Full Ranking Of Scripts|url=http://blogs.indiewire.com/theplaylist/watch-elizabeth-banks-daniel-radcliffe-rian-johnson-and-more-announce-2014-black-list-plus-full-ranking-of-scripts-20141215|website=Indiewire|accessdate=January 10, 2014|date=December 15, 2014}}[https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=t5aQVxhRQ5o' Tyler Shields The Wild Ones] Nov 18th, 2014 Shields directed the 2015 action thriller film Final Girl, which starred Abigail Breslin.{{cite web|url=http://www.dreadcentral.com/news/117144/witness-a-final-girl-in-training/|title=Witness a Final Girl in Training – Dread Central|date=4 August 2015|publisher=}}
